Selecting a research vendor requires rigorous vendor qualification to safeguard assay integrity. Substandard suppliers often cut costs on analytical testing, leading to mislabeled purity levels, batch variability, or residual contaminant toxicity. When evaluating potential vendors, lab directors should watch for critical red flags:
1. Recycled or Generic COAs: Vendors that display a single, static Certificate of Analysis without batch-specific lot numbers or recent testing dates are often reselling unverified grey-market inventory.
2. Absence of Mass Spectrometry (MS) Data: High-Performance Liquid Chromatography (HPLC) alone only measures sample purity percentage; it cannot confirm correct molecular mass or sequence identity. MS data is mandatory for structural confirmation.
3. Missing Endotoxin Screenings: Bacterial endotoxins (lipopolysaccharides) can alter cellular responses in in-vitro assays and induce severe inflammatory responses in animal models, corrupting experimental data.
4. Overseas Drop-Shipping: Suppliers masking foreign fulfillment behind a domestic address introduce customs risks, prolonged shipping times, and compromised cold-chain oversight.

Cagrilintide is a long-acting, synthetic acylated amylin analog studied extensively in preclinical models of metabolic regulation and energy balance. Preclinical research indicates that Cagrilintide acts as a non-selective agonist at both human amylin (AMY) receptors and calcitonin (CTR) receptors. By binding to these neuroendocrine receptor complexes, the compound is investigated for its role in modulating homeostatic food intake and gastric emptying rates in animal models.
In published literature, researchers frequently examine the comparative and synergistic actions of amylin receptor agonists when combined with glucagon-like peptide-1 (GLP-1) receptor agonists, such as Semaglutide or dual GLP-1/GIP agonists like Tirzepatide. In-vitro binding studies suggest that Cagrilintide exhibits high receptor affinity and sustained plasma half-life due to strategic fatty acid acylation, making it a valuable tool for investigating central appetite signaling and metabolic expenditure mechanisms.

1. Semaglutide: A selective GLP-1 receptor agonist widely utilized in studies evaluating glycemic control, central satiety signaling, and energy homeostasis.
2. Tirzepatide: A dual GIP and GLP-1 receptor agonist studied for synergistic metabolic signaling and enhanced insulin sensitivity in animal models.
3. Retatrutide: A triple hormone receptor agonist targeting GIP, GLP-1, and glucagon receptors, investigated for maximal metabolic rate modulation.
